Veteran NYSE trader says AI rally differs from dot-com peak

Peter Tuchman, a longtime New York Stock Exchange trader, said he is not worried that the current AI-driven stock rally is headed for a crash like past market collapses.

Tuchman pointed to stronger earnings and lower valuations among leading AI-linked companies compared with many dot-com-era stocks. Nvidia is trading at 24.8 times forward earnings, while Cisco traded above 100 times forward earnings at its peak.

He also cited continued retail investor support. Federal Reserve data show the top 10% of Americans by wealth own 87% of U.S. stocks and mutual fund shares, and JPMorgan found retail investors bought $270 billion in stocks in the first half of 2026.
